当前位置: 首页 > news >正文

淮安企业网站制作校园网网络规划与设计方案

淮安企业网站制作,校园网网络规划与设计方案,银川商城网站建设,国外有做塑料粒子的网站吗在 Flutter 中#xff0c;DraggableScrollableSheet 是一个非常有用的小部件#xff0c;它允许用户通过手势来拖动一个可滚动的区域#xff0c;通常被用作底部弹出式面板或者随手势拖动的控件。本文将介绍 DraggableScrollableSheet 的属性以及如何在 Flutter 中使用它。 D…在 Flutter 中DraggableScrollableSheet 是一个非常有用的小部件它允许用户通过手势来拖动一个可滚动的区域通常被用作底部弹出式面板或者随手势拖动的控件。本文将介绍 DraggableScrollableSheet 的属性以及如何在 Flutter 中使用它。 DraggableScrollableSheet 属性介绍 initialChildSize: 设置 DraggableScrollableSheet 初始时的高度占屏幕的比例。范围为 0 到 1默认值为 0.5即初始高度为屏幕高度的一半。 minChildSize: 指定 DraggableScrollableSheet 的最小高度占屏幕的比例。默认为 0表示没有最小高度限制。 maxChildSize: 指定 DraggableScrollableSheet 的最大高度占屏幕的比例。默认为 1表示没有最大高度限制。 expand: 设置是否允许 DraggableScrollableSheet 在内容小于屏幕高度时扩展以填充屏幕。默认为 true。 snap: 一个布尔值用于控制是否启用 DraggableScrollableSheet 在滚动停止时自动捕捉到接近的最小或最大值。默认值为 false。 builder: 一个构建函数用于构建 DraggableScrollableSheet 的内容。该函数接受两个参数BuildContext 和 ScrollController返回一个 Widget通常是一个 SingleChildScrollView 或者 ListView。 如何使用 DraggableScrollableSheet 下面是一个简单的示例展示了如何在 Flutter 中使用 DraggableScrollableSheet import package:flutter/material.dart;void main() {runApp(MyApp()); }class MyApp extends StatelessWidget {overrideWidget build(BuildContext context) {return MaterialApp(home: Scaffold(appBar: AppBar(title: Text(DraggableScrollableSheet Example),),body: MyHomePage(),),);} }class MyHomePage extends StatelessWidget {overrideWidget build(BuildContext context) {return Center(child: ElevatedButton(onPressed: () {showModalBottomSheet(context: context,builder: (context) {return DraggableScrollableSheet(initialChildSize: 0.5,minChildSize: 0.25,maxChildSize: 0.75,expand: true,snap: true,builder: (context, scrollController) {return Container(color: Colors.grey[300],child: ListView.builder(controller: scrollController,itemCount: 25,itemBuilder: (context, index) {return ListTile(title: Text(Item $index),);},),);},);},);},child: Text(Show DraggableScrollableSheet),),);} }在这个示例中我们创建了一个简单的 Flutter 应用并在其中使用了 DraggableScrollableSheet。当用户点击按钮时会弹出一个底部弹出式面板其中包含一个可滚动的 ListView。 通过调整 DraggableScrollableSheet 的属性可以根据需要定制弹出式面板的行为和外观。例如通过调整 initialChildSize、minChildSize、maxChildSize 和 snap 可以控制面板的初始高度、最小高度、最大高度以及滚动停止时的自动捕捉行为。
http://www.zqtcl.cn/news/316805/

相关文章:

  • html完整网站开发自媒体平台账号注册
  • 厦门seo网站网站空间 群集
  • 青岛网站推广方案营销自动化平台
  • 管理信息系统与网站建设有什么区别python版wordpress
  • 济南市建设行政主管部门网站公众号登录入口官网
  • 深圳苏州企业网站建设服务企业做网站需要什么条件
  • 电脑什么网站可以做长图攻略公众号 微网站开发
  • 网站核检单怎么用小皮创建网站
  • 企业网站托管平台有哪些烟台高新区建设局网站
  • 石家庄网站做网站和县网页定制
  • 网站个人备案和企业备案潍坊公司注册网站
  • 建个网站的流程互联网裁员
  • 设置网站模板汉口网站建设公司
  • 网站对一个关键词做排名怎么做网站建设 图纸网
  • 什么网站比较吸引流量网页设计代码td
  • 克隆网站怎么做后台wordpress网站缩
  • 仁怀哪儿做网站泰安市建设局
  • 做网站和编程有关系吗手机怎么做电子书下载网站
  • 网站做关键词排名网站快速排名的方法
  • 有网站模板如何预览泉州app开发
  • 网站自助建站系统重庆皇华建设集团有限公司网站
  • 云速成美站做网站好吗汕头制作网站
  • 搜狗搜索网站提交入口在哪里做卖车网站
  • 河南省百城建设提质网站新人怎么做电商
  • 建设机械网站制作创建个人网站教案
  • 无锡网站推广装修风格大全2023新款
  • 在线设计logo免费网站如何在网站上添加qq
  • 高端网站建设哪里好网站建设与管理案例教程
  • 云南专业网站建设上海百度移动关键词排名优化
  • 如何搭建一个完整的网站wordpress 小程序开发